Blog: New Politics welcomes Michael Joffrion to the team!

New Politics is excited to welcome Michael Joffrion to the team as a new Senior Campaign Advisor! Joffrion will lead New Politics’ growth on the Republican side of the aisle, helping recruit and advise candidates and their campaigns across the country.

He joins the team having served on multiple Republican presidential and U.S. Senate campaigns, the National Republican Senatorial Committee, and the Alabama Republican Party. Joffrion is widely viewed as one of the most experienced Republican strategists in the country.

“Our democracy doesn’t work if leaders don’t bring a sense of service and a commitment to putting country over party. We need servant leaders on both sides of the aisle who are dedicated to putting others first,” said Joffrion. “I’m thrilled to join the New Politics team and bring an important perspective to our critical work of revitalizing our democracy.”

Michael’s Full Bio

Michael Joffrion is a Senior Campaign Advisor at New Politics, where he serves as a personal advisor, coach, and liaison to Republican candidates and senior campaign staff. He provides strategic guidance on various verticals, including organizing, communications, and paid media, and works closely with campaigns to help build strong values and culture.

Before joining New Politics, Michael ran his own general consulting and public affairs firm, managed former United States Senator Luther Strange’s Senate campaign, and served as Regional Political Director at the National Republican Senatorial Committee from 2013-2016.

Previously, Michael managed North Carolina for Mitt Romney’s campaign for President, winning the only target state in 2012. Prior to managing North Carolina in the general election, he was the Southern Regional Political Director during the primary. Michael served as the Political Director for the Alabama Republican Party from 2008 to 2012.  

Michael got his start in campaigns by building grassroots programs and applying data and analytics while working for Rudy Giuliani’s presidential campaign in Iowa, the RNC’s Victory program in Missouri, and the United Kingdom’s House of Commons.

Michael holds a B.A. in Political Science and a Master’s in Public Administration from Auburn University. He and his wife, Jennifer, reside in Vestavia Hills, Alabama with their young son and daughter. On Saturdays during the fall, you can find the Joffrions wearing orange and blue inside Jordan-Hare Stadium in Auburn.
